Nickel Plate 2-8-4 No. 765 pays a visit to Scranton, PA, seen here ducking former DL&W signals on the first of a series of excursions out of Steamtown, to the Delaware Water Gap and return. The Nay Aug tunnel is up just ahead,
The Van Swearingen Brothers standarized freight power for their railroads with nearly identical 2-8-4 Berkshires. Two of these engines are still in excursion service.
